We’re working with a highly regarded independent lettings business in Bristol looking to appoint an experienced Property Manager to join their growing team. This is an excellent opportunity to join a well-established independent agency with a proud local reputation. The business continues to grow whilst consistently delivering a high level of service and is now looking for an organised and proactive individual who wants to grow with the company long term.

What's in it for you?

  • Package: £28,000–£35,000
  • Monday–Friday (no weekends)
  • ARLA qualifications funded
  • Genuine progression opportunities
  • Established independent agency

Responsibilities

  • Managing tenant maintenance issues
  • Liaising with landlords and contractors
  • Coordinating repairs and compliance
  • Carrying out property inspections
  • Managing end-of-tenancy processes
  • Handling invoices and property records
  • Delivering excellent customer service
  • Supporting the wider property team

About you:

  • Property management experience
  • Strong communication skills
  • Professional and personable
  • Able to manage a busy workload

How to prepare for a job interview at Walker & Sloan

Know Your Stuff

Make sure you brush up on your property management knowledge. Familiarise yourself with the latest regulations, tenant rights, and maintenance processes. This will not only show your expertise but also demonstrate your commitment to staying updated in the field.

Showcase Your Communication Skills

As a Senior Property Manager, strong communication is key. Prepare examples of how you've effectively liaised with landlords, tenants, and contractors in the past. Think about specific situations where your communication made a difference in resolving issues or improving relationships.

Demonstrate Organisational Skills

This role requires managing a busy workload, so be ready to discuss how you prioritise tasks and stay organised. Bring along examples of tools or methods you use to keep track of maintenance requests, inspections, and compliance checks.

Emphasise Customer Service

Walker & Sloan value excellent customer service, so prepare to talk about your approach to delivering it. Share stories that highlight your ability to handle difficult situations with tenants or landlords, and how you ensure everyone feels valued and heard.
